The Honor 300 serves as the vital gateway to Honor’s upper mid-range lineup in South Africa. Priced from ZAR 8,500, it hits a highly strategic bracket—sitting right under the Pro variant to offer high-end performance, an elegant ultra-slim build, and advanced portrait photography for buyers who want premium features without entering five-figure price territory.

What Does ZAR 8,500 Get You?

By stripping away non-essential luxury extras like wireless charging, the standard Honor 300 channels all of its budget into foundational flagship specs: elite screen tech, massive charging speeds, and a design that feels incredibly premium.

Featherlight Design and Eye-Care OLED Display

The most striking physical characteristic of the Honor 300 is its ultra-slim profile. Measuring a mere 6.97mm in thickness and weighing just 175 grams, it feels exceptionally sleek in the hand. The front is dominated by a flat 6.7-inch AMOLED display operating at a fluid 120Hz refresh rate. It features an incredible peak brightness of 4,000 nits for seamless outdoor viewing under bright sunlight, backed by industry-leading 3,840Hz high-frequency PWM dimming to eliminate eye strain during low-light browsing.

Powerful, Sustained Processing

Running the device is the highly efficient Qualcomm Snapdragon 7 Gen 3 processor built on a 4nm architecture. Backed by generous RAM allocations and 256GB of base internal storage, it glides through everyday social media management, productivity apps, and multi-tasking. To prevent performance drops during prolonged gaming or heavy workloads, Honor has packed an advanced stainless steel Bionic Vapor Chamber cooling system inside the slim chassis.

Dual 50MP “Portrait Master” Cameras

The phone completely rethinks mid-range mobile photography by anchoring its system on high-grade sensors. The rear houses a dual layout featuring a 50MP primary shooter with Optical Image Stabilization (OIS) using a high-end Sony sensor, paired with a versatile 12MP ultra-wide lens that doubles as a close-up macro shooter. Up front, social media creators get a major upgrade with a matching, ultra-sharp 50MP selfie camera capable of recording crisp 4K footage.

Flagship Charging Capabilities

Despite its razor-thin 7mm profile, the phone accommodates a high-density 5,300 mAh silicon-carbon battery that easily sails through an entire day of heavy 5G usage. When it’s time to juice up, the Honor 300 utilizes an astonishing 100W SuperCharge wired architecture—capable of filling more than half the battery in just 15 minutes, ensuring you spend less time anchored to wall sockets during power outages.

The Verdict: At ZAR 8,500, the Honor 300 presents a balanced masterclass in design and core utilities. It effectively democratizes top-tier display tech, robust performance, and 100W charging speeds, making it a stellar option for anyone shopping just beneath true flagship prices.
